Nabamunda is a Rural village located in Khamar, Anugul, Odisha.

The total population of Nabamunda is 36.

Nabamunda village comprises 9 households.

The literacy rate in Nabamunda is 64.5%. Among the literate population of 20, there are 10 literate males and 10 literate females.

In Nabamunda, there are 17 males and 19 females, with a sex ratio of 1118 females per 1000 males.

There are 5 children (13.9% of population), comprising 3 boys and 2 girls.

The total number of workers in Nabamunda is 17, with 11 main workers and 6 marginal workers.

In Nabamunda, there are 0 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(0 males, 0 females) and 22 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(10 males, 12 females).

Nabamunda is located in Odisha state, Anugul district, and falls under Khamar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 403644 and LGD code is 403644.
